2017-01-26 1 views
0

私は外部の人々にデータを提供するArduinoプロジェクトに取り組んでいましたが、私は家族やゲストのためだけに保管したいと考えています。そこでログイン認証ページを設定して、ローカルにホストされているPHPウェブサイト(ポートフォワーディング経由でインターネット経由で利用可能)でデータを見ることができます。しかし、ログインはusername/passwordを格納するデータベースを必要とするので、それをdynamoDbに保存しておきたい。私はAWSにオンラインで保存することは良いアイデアだと思います.DBは時間が経つにつれて成長しますが、PHPページは保存して簡単に移動できるためです。私が試してみたいもう一つの理由は、Dynamo DBでNoSQLを使う方法を学ぶことです!Amazon DynamoDbにローカル接続されたphpホストを持つことは可能ですか?

ログインを保存するためにAmazon DynamoDbを使用する、ローカルにphpをホストする正しいパスを教えてください。

答えて

2

資格情報を持っている限り、Amazon環境の外部からDynamoDBに確実に接続できます。 PHP Getting Started Guideは、必要なものを最大限に活用する必要があります。

EC2インスタンスに移行する準備ができたら、t2.nanoマシンは月額約4.32ドルです。これにより、データベースと通信できる完全なPHPサーバーをセットアップできるようになり、ローカルに置く必要はありません。

+0

Amazon Cloudでデータベースをオンラインにしているので、エンドポイントを変更するだけで済みます。 –

+0

実際には、エンドポイントは同じままです。あなたはEC2インスタンスに資格を取得する必要がありますが、それはIAMの役割ではかなり簡単です。それ以外の場合は、単純な移行でなければなりません。 – stdunbar

+0

しかし、EC2は1年後に削除されることを意味します。それとも、IAMルールでインスタンスを維持するために支払う必要があります。 –

関連する問題